Neymar (£12.0m) got his second of the World Cup as Brazil were able to get past Mexico without reaching their scintillating best.

The Selecao had to be patient after Mexico matched the former champions in the first-half. The central Americans also deployed an interesting tactical ploy for corners, by leaving most of their attacking players on the half-way line to commit Brazil’s centre-backs away from the penalty area.

It was Neymar’s skill that made the difference in the end, though. He had the ball on the edge of the box in the 51st minute and drove across the edge of the ‘D’, committing three defenders before back-heeling to an unmarked Willian (£8.4m).

The Chelsea man pushed on into the penalty area unchallenged and whipped a ball across the box where Neymar had reached the back-post to finish.

Brazil’s second came in the 88th minute after Roberto Firmino (£8.3m) had come on for Philippe Coutinho (£9.1m), whose blank against Mexico was his first of the tournament.

Neymar’s shot from the left forced a decent save out of Guillermo Ochoa (£5.1m), removing a potential assist on McDonald’s FIFA World Cup Fantasy, before Firmino completed a routine finish.

Fantasy managers who had captained Romelu Lukaku (£10.1m) were left a little frustrated as he registered no returns in a match with five goal-scorers.

Japan raced into a 2-0 lead at the start of the second-half with several budget options delivering points. In the 48th minute Gaku Shibasaki (£5.0m) sent Genki Haraguchi (£5.9m) through, whose fierce shot across goal nestled in the bottom left-hand corner of Thibaut Courtois’ (£6.0m) goal.

Four minutes later, Shinji Kagawa (£6.5m) teed up Takashi Inui (£4.6m) on the edge of the box who thumped the ball into the bottom right-hand corner. Belgium were stunned but still managed to fight back as Maroune Fellaini (£6.9m) and Nacer Chadli (£6.9m) came on for Yannick Carrasco (£6.5m) and Dries Mertens (£9.0m).

Those changes were in response to Japan putting high pressure on Belgium’s wing-backs, who could be at risk of rotation in future rounds accordingly.

Jan Vertonghen (£5.9m) got the Red Devils back into the game in the 69th minute with a looping header from the edge of the box which caught Eiji Kawashima (£4.4m) off-guard. Shortly after, Fellaini’s towering header from an Eden Hazard (£10.1m) cross hit the back of the net to make it 2-2.

Belgium’s winner was scored with virtually the last kick of the game. Japan had committed men forward to a corner in the 96th minute and were hit on the counter. Kevin De Bruyne (£9.9m) played the all-important pass out wide to Thomas Meunier (£6.0m), whose square ball across the box was left by Lukaku and turned in by Chadli.
